Tucked away in a quiet cul de sac, this modernised semi-detached house offers spacious accommodation comprising; three bedrooms, refitted kitchen and bathroom, generous living room, downstairs WC, enclosed garden, garage and parking for multiple vehicles.

Entering in the front door, a hallway with downstairs WC and stairs leading to first floor landing gives access to each the kitchen and the living room. The front aspect kitchen has a modern range of wall and base level units with integrated appliances and space for a dining table. The living room overlooks and leads to the rear garden via French doors and is bright with laminate flooring.

Upstairs, there are three generously-sized bedrooms the large two with built in wardrobes and the third a large single. Completing the upper level is a refitted contemporary bathroom, showcasing sleek fixtures and finishes with bath with shower over, low level WC and hand basin in vanity unit.

The rear garden is well maintained and is mainly laid to lawn with shrub and bush borders, with a garden room with power which could be used as a home office. To the front the property has a garage in block and the ability to park several cars in front of it along with parking adjacent to the house.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
